046 <br /> 2 <br /> standard. and since evidence had not been <br /> presented to indicate the project would maintain <br /> the value of existing properties in the area. <br /> The effect of the court ruling was to place <br /> Chandler Concrete Company in violation of the <br /> Orange County Zoning Ordinance. <br /> 10/5/87 - The Board of Commissioners approved a request by <br /> Chandler Concrete to expand the Ten-Year <br /> Transition Area and Commercial- Industrial <br /> Activity Node by an additional 0 .59 acres. <br /> Combined with the 1.41 acres currently in the <br /> same designation. the two-acre lot size <br /> requirement could be met. <br /> NCDOT has indicated that a driveway permit will be required <br /> for driveway "D" (the easternmost driveway) . This permit <br /> has been obtained and the driveway constructed. <br /> Encroachment agreements will be required if any drainage <br /> structures or other work is performed within the right-of- <br /> way of Old N.C. Highway 10 . <br /> Both the Orange Rural Fire Department and the Orange County <br /> Rescue Squad have indicated their ability to provide <br /> emergency services to the site. The Sheriff' s Department <br /> has indicated that no additional manpower will be needed. <br /> The Erosion Control Officer has indicated that a stormwater <br /> management plan will be required for the project. The <br /> Recreation Director has indicated no elements exist which <br /> would warrant comment from a recreation perspective. <br /> RECOMMENDATION: The Planning Staff recommends approval of the request with <br /> conditions (see attachment) . <br />
